Magnetic Clasps for Health Jewelry




No more hassling with tiny jewelry clasps.

Magnetic jewelry clasps hold tight yet separate with ease. Each clasp requires 2 round or square magnetic beads on each end. The magnets are the last to be strung and then the string is knotted.
The clasp can be separated at either end and will snap together again when held close to the beads,

yet it will not come apart with an accidental tug.
Elderly people, those with arthritis, joint problems, or hand injures can still fasten their own

bracelets, anklets, and necklaces with ease. Clasps come in packs of 12.
